Jeliazko R. Jeliazkov is a leading figure in computational protein design, a field at the intersection of structural biology, biophysics, and artificial intelligence. His research focuses on developing innovative algorithms to engineer proteins with precise, functional geometries—a critical challenge for advancing medicine and biotechnology. His most cited work, "Accurate positioning of functional residues with robotics-inspired computational protein design" (2022, 10 citations), introduces a novel approach that borrows principles from robotics to achieve atom-level accuracy in designing active sites and binding interfaces. This breakthrough enables the creation of proteins with tailored functions, from catalysts to therapeutics, overcoming long-standing limitations in the field.
